Oxford Reading Tree All Stars: Oxford Level 11: The Lifeguard Dog by Meg Harper

Duke is a brave lifeguard dog, until he is banned from the beach. Can his owner Hattie save Duke's job? Oxford Reading Tree All Stars is an engaging chapter fiction series which combines age-appropriate content with imaginative stories, perfect for inspiring and stretching able infants. The series develops comprehension skills and provides a wide variety of fiction topics and styles, alongside illustrations that aid understanding. All the books in this series are carefully levelled, so it's easy to match every child to the right book - one which will develop their reading skills and fuel their love of reading.
